  • Amsterdam's DGTL Festival has announced its 2015 opening night party, taking place at NDSM Docklands on Friday, April 3rd. The main portion of DGTL runs across April 4th and 5th, also at NDSM Docklands. The opening night party will be held in the Scheepsbouwloods (ship building) section of the sprawling space. A UK-heavy lineup has been assembled, comprising Four Tet, a Mount Kimbie DJ set and a live slot from Dark Sky. Locals Dekmantel Soundsystem and Young Marco will also get behind the decks. The party will kick off at 9 PM and last for around 13 hours. DGTL Festival—which this year features names like Dixon, Âme, Recondite, Move D and Motor City Drum Ensemble—will begin a few hours later at midday.
